BOYS’ BRIGADE COMPETITION

Physical Training Trophy The Canterbury Battalion of the Boys' Brigade held tts annual physical training competition at the week-end Boys from Christchurch. Ranglors. and Kaiapol took part The John Burns troph.v was won by the 28th Chrfstehurrh Company < St. Peter's Presbyterian) The judges. Messrs K. Plunkett, M. Read and R Swindell. said the standard of performance showed a marked Improvement on previous years.
